Evolutionary Psychology
An analytical framework applied in both social and natural sciences that investigates the psychological framework through the lens of contemporary evolutionary theory.
Change Blindness
A phenomenon where observers fail to notice substantial changes in the visual details of a scene when the change occurs during a visual disruption.
Neuroscience
The scientific study of the nervous system, including its structure, function, development, genetics, biochemistry, physiology, pharmacology, and pathology.
Cognition
All aspects of thinking, knowing, and understanding reflecting mental activities such as attention, memory, problem-solving, and language comprehension.
